Abstract

An effective coordination in an interconnected system can be obtained by ensuring proper settings of overcurrent relays. In this research work, the problem of coordinating the overcurrent relays is formulated as a non‐linear problem, taking into account the as discrete nature of time dial settings and the pickup current settings. An effective approach based on adaptive differential evolution (ADE) algorithm is proposed to solve the coordination problem. The results obtained by ADE are compared with different algorithms on different model test systems and found to be feasible, robust and efficient. [ABSTRACT FROM AUTHOR]
